> Currently if AES or DES algorithms fail for Docsis test suite,
> a segmentation fault occurs when cryptodev_qat_autotest is ran.
> 
> This is due to a duplicate call of EVP_CIPHER_CTX_free for the
> session context. Ctx is freed firstly in the bpi_cipher_ctx_init
> function and then again at the end of qat_sym_session_configure_cipher
> function.
> 
> This commit fixes this bug by removing the first instance
> of EVP_CIPHER_CTX_free, leaving just the dedicated function in
> the upper level to free the ctx.
> 
> Fixes: 98f0608 ("crypto/qat: add symmetric session file")
> Cc: fiona.tr...@intel.com
> Cc: sta...@dpdk.org
> 
> Signed-off-by: Rebecca Troy <rebecca.t...@intel.com>
> Acked-by: Fan Zhang <roy.fan.zh...@intel.com>
Applied to dpdk-next-crypto

Thanks.

Reply via email to